Output 20ded199cb512cfcbbe9e8e4acbf2dfcd19a93d5a280d1513018413cee497140:26

value
39076250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b84345114547bcdf51033136a8f90b1af14e416 OP_EQUAL
address
35f7MWgabC8bWYqeAv21sFXH4xCXzhjaXF
transaction
20ded199cb512cfcbbe9e8e4acbf2dfcd19a93d5a280d1513018413cee497140
spent
true